Modulo Calculator for Large Numbers
Calculate remainders efficiently with our advanced modular arithmetic tool
Modulo Calculator
Calculate the remainder when dividing large numbers using modular arithmetic.
For power modulo: (base^exponent) mod divisor = remainder.
Modulo Operations Visualization
| Operation | Input Values | Result | Description |
|---|---|---|---|
| Basic Modulo | 123456789012345 mod 987654321 | – | Standard modulo operation |
| Power Modulo | (123456789012345^3) mod 987654321 | – | Modular exponentiation |
| Alternative Method | Using modular properties | – | Step-by-step reduction |
What is how to find mod of large numbers using calculator?
The process of how to find mod of large numbers using calculator involves calculating the remainder when dividing very large integers. This mathematical operation, known as modular arithmetic, is essential in cryptography, computer science, and various mathematical applications where working with large numbers directly would be computationally intensive.
Modular arithmetic helps simplify calculations with large numbers by focusing only on the remainder after division. When dealing with how to find mod of large numbers using calculator tools, the primary goal is to determine what remains after one large number is divided by another without performing the full division operation.
Anyone working with cryptography, computer algorithms, or mathematical computations involving large numbers should understand how to find mod of large numbers using calculator methods. Common misconceptions include believing that standard calculators can handle extremely large numbers, when in fact specialized methods or software is often required for accurate results.
how to find mod of large numbers using calculator Formula and Mathematical Explanation
The fundamental formula for how to find mod of large numbers using calculator is straightforward: a mod n = r, where ‘a’ is the dividend, ‘n’ is the divisor, and ‘r’ is the remainder such that 0 ≤ r < n. For large numbers, we often use properties like (a × b) mod n = ((a mod n) × (b mod n)) mod n to break down complex calculations.
When implementing how to find mod of large numbers using calculator techniques, especially for modular exponentiation, we use algorithms like binary exponentiation which reduce the computational complexity significantly. This method repeatedly squares the base and reduces modulo n at each step.
| Variable | Meaning | Unit | Typical Range |
|---|---|---|---|
| a | Dividend (large number) | Integer | 1 to 10^18+ |
| n | Divisor (modulus) | Integer | 2 to 10^18 |
| r | Remainder | Integer | 0 to n-1 |
| b | Base (for exponentiation) | Integer | 1 to n-1 |
| e | Exponent | Integer | 1 to 10^18 |
Practical Examples (Real-World Use Cases)
Example 1 – RSA Cryptography: In RSA encryption, we need to calculate (message^e) mod n where both the message and exponent e can be very large. Using how to find mod of large numbers using calculator methods, we apply modular exponentiation to compute this efficiently. For instance, calculating (123456789^65537) mod 323232323 requires breaking down the exponent and applying modular properties at each step.
Example 2 – Hash Functions: Many hash functions use modular arithmetic with large primes. For example, when implementing a hash function that computes hash = (key × multiplier) mod prime, understanding how to find mod of large numbers using calculator techniques ensures accuracy even with very large keys. A practical scenario might involve computing (987654321098765 × 123456789) mod 1000000007.
How to Use This how to find mod of large numbers using calculator
To effectively use this how to find mod of large numbers using calculator, start by entering your dividend (the large number you want to divide) in the first input field. Next, enter your divisor in the second field. If you’re performing modular exponentiation, also enter the exponent in the third field. Click “Calculate Modulo” to get your results.
Reading the results is straightforward: the primary result shows the remainder after division. The intermediate values provide additional context including the quotient (if applicable), the remainder, the division type being performed, and details about any power operations. For decision-making, focus on the primary result while considering the intermediate values to verify correctness.
Key Factors That Affect how to find mod of large numbers using calculator Results
- Number Size: Extremely large numbers may require special handling due to calculator limitations. Understanding how to find mod of large numbers using calculator techniques becomes crucial when dealing with numbers beyond standard precision limits.
- Precision Requirements: Some applications require exact precision while others allow approximations. The precision needed affects which method you choose when implementing how to find mod of large numbers using calculator operations.
- Computational Complexity: Large number operations can be computationally expensive. Efficient algorithms like binary exponentiation are essential when studying how to find mod of large numbers using calculator methods.
- Algorithm Choice: Different algorithms work better for different types of problems. Understanding which algorithm to use is fundamental to mastering how to find mod of large numbers using calculator techniques.
- Hardware Limitations: Calculator and computer hardware impose limits on number sizes. Knowledge of these constraints is important when learning how to find mod of large numbers using calculator approaches.
- Mathematical Properties: Properties like distributivity and associativity of modular arithmetic affect calculation strategies. These properties are essential when exploring how to find mod of large numbers using calculator methods.
- Error Handling: Proper error handling prevents incorrect results. When studying how to find mod of large numbers using calculator implementations, always include checks for invalid inputs.
- Optimization Techniques: Techniques like pre-computation and caching can speed up repeated calculations. These optimizations are valuable aspects of how to find mod of large numbers using calculator implementations.
Frequently Asked Questions (FAQ)
Related Tools and Internal Resources
Find the greatest common divisor of two numbers using Euclidean algorithm
Calculate the least common multiple of integers efficiently
Break down numbers into their prime components
Convert between decimal, binary, octal, and hexadecimal systems
Perform RSA encryption and decryption operations
Comprehensive guide to modular arithmetic principles